Output e54d44bf20948d8eb4a2ab7a58dfd85315ceaf974d3d74eaa1daefe289cc4def:1

value
29586
script pubkey
OP_0 OP_PUSHBYTES_20 4126ac6b5fb04672984f2163a72e2f2b1a7077bc
address
bc1qgyn2c66lkpr89xz0y936wt309vd8qaaumzpu27
transaction
e54d44bf20948d8eb4a2ab7a58dfd85315ceaf974d3d74eaa1daefe289cc4def
confirmations
15232
spent
true